Transaction 7e89869771509fcd540de88c6fbd3a4aa3b7f797138bb75e9dbe39461d9a9704

1 Input
2 Outputs
  • 7e89869771509fcd540de88c6fbd3a4aa3b7f797138bb75e9dbe39461d9a9704:0
  • value  500000
    address  3Q1AQvWz2Z9Uhj2n2HRyFhwoc2mLTpqYaX
  • 7e89869771509fcd540de88c6fbd3a4aa3b7f797138bb75e9dbe39461d9a9704:1
  • value  1615772
    address  3BhstqM369PurAWAPtAsHSadMcjZeZy1Ni